Quick Assessment

This early reader biography introduces young children to Taylor Swift's life, highlighting her musical journey from Pennsylvania to Nashville and her evolution from country to pop stardom. The book includes accessible text aligned with Common Core standards and features educational elements like a glossary and fact boxes. Suitable for ages 5-8, it offers a positive portrayal of dedication and philanthropy without any concerning content.
